+ # SambaLingo-Hungarian-Chat
15
+
16
+ <img src="SambaLingo_Logo.png" width="340" style="margin-left:'auto' margin-right:'auto' display:'block'"/>
17
+
18
+ <!-- Provide a quick summary of what the model is/does. -->
19
+ SambaLingo-Hungarian-Chat is a human aligned chat model trained in Hungarian and English. It is trained using direct preference optimization on top the base model [SambaLingo-Hungarian-Base](https://huggingface.co/sambanovasystems/SambaLingo-Hungarian-Base). The base model adapts [Llama-2-7b](https://huggingface.co/meta-llama/Llama-2-7b-hf) to Hungarian by training on 59 billion tokens from the Hungarian split of the [Cultura-X](https://huggingface.co/datasets/uonlp/CulturaX) dataset. + ## Training Details
88
+ The alignment phase follows the recipe for [Zephyr-7B](https://huggingface.co/HuggingFaceH4/zephyr-7b-beta), and comprises two stages: supervised fine-tuning (SFT) and Direct Performance Optimization (DPO).
89
+
90
+ The SFT phase was done on the [ultrachat_200k](https://huggingface.co/datasets/HuggingFaceH4/ultrachat_200k) dataset mixed with the Google translated version of the ultrachat_200k dataset. It was trained for one epoch with global batch size 512 and max sequence length 2048 tokens. We used a linear decay learning rate of 2e-5 and 10% warmup.
91
+
92
+ The DPO phase was done on the [ultrafeedback](https://huggingface.co/datasets/HuggingFaceH4/ultrafeedback_binarized) dataset and [cai-conversation-harmless](https://huggingface.co/datasets/HuggingFaceH4/cai-conversation-harmless) dataset, mixed with 10% of the data Google translated. It was trained with global batch size 32 and for three epochs. We used a linear decay learning rate of 5e-7, 10% warmup and β=0.1 as the regularization factor for DPO.
93
+
94
+
95
+ ## Tokenizer Details
96
+ We extended the vocabulary of the base llama model from 32,000 tokens to 57,000 tokens by adding up to 25,000 non-overlapping tokens from the new language.

+ ## Bias, Risks, and Limitations
120
+
121
+ <!-- This section is meant to convey both technical and sociotechnical limitations. -->
122
+
123
+ Like all LLMs, SambaLingo has certain limitations:
124
+ - Hallucination: Model may sometimes generate responses that contain plausible-sounding but factually incorrect or irrelevant information.
125
+ - Code Switching: The model might unintentionally switch between languages or dialects within a single response, affecting the coherence and understandability of the output.
126
+ - Repetition: The Model may produce repetitive phrases or sentences, leading to less engaging and informative responses.
127
+ - Coding and Math: The model's performance in generating accurate code or solving complex mathematical problems may be limited.
128
+ - Toxicity: The model could inadvertently generate responses containing inappropriate or harmful content.
